    If you have good water coolling, you should be able to hit 4Ghz without much of a problem. You will need at least 1.5-1.55v to achieve some stability. GO stepping makes it easier to do modest overclocks by entreme forum standards. I can get 3.2Ghz at stock speeds. You can't do that with the non GO stepping. So in theory, you should be able to overclock much higher at lower voltages with the GO processor.

    If you can settle for 3.4-3.5Ghz, you can achieve this with probably around 1.4v without too much trouble.

    Q6600 L725A903 Max FSB Tests

    Seems Asus Blitz Formula of mine has slightly better FSB for Q6600 L725A903 than Asus Blitz Extreme. On Blitz Formula, the Q6600 L725A903 could easily hit 490FSB before needing CPU PLL voltage adjustments compared with Blitz Extreme 485FSB mark. Also max bootable FSB was 505FSB vs 500FSB in favour for Blitz Formula.

    But for any form of stability i.e. Super Pi 32M or Quad 16M Systool PI test, it was pretty close 495FSB for Blitz Formula on air versus 493FSB for Blitz Extreme on H20 cooling.

    Get p95 v25.1 it does 4 threads automatically. Small fft for CPU, blend for both cpu and mem.
